This geocache is part of the 2016 Jaxparks Geocaching Challenge! The City of Jacksonville is proud to bring you the 5th annual Jaxparks Geocaching Challenge! In each JaxParks Geocache, you'll find a small stamp. Simply stamp your 2016 Geocaching Challenge Passport in the appropriate spots as you visit each geocache. When you've collected 25 of the 30 stamps, you'll qualify for the coin!
